A Modeling and Verification Method of Modbus TCP/IP Protocol

초록

With the informatization of industrial control system, industrial communication protocol is facing greater data pressure. At the same time, industrial communication protocols will face more security threats. In this paper, we use the method of transforming STM (State Transition Matrix) model to UPPAAL (a tool for verifying real-time system) model. In order to clearly understand the model and avoid some mistakes in the early stage of modeling, we first establish STM model for Modbus TCP/IP protocol. Finally, it is transformed into UPPAAL model. Five types of attributes are verified by UPPAAL tool, including the verification of unreachable attributes found by STM modeling. These five types of attributes verify the credibility of Modbus TCP/IP protocol. The experimental results show that this method can have a clear understanding of the model in the early stage. After converting STM model into UPPAAL model, more constraints can be found by referring to STM model. Compared with the existing methods, it studies the credibility of the protocol itself. Therefore, the method can find the root of the problem and solve it.
